About Rehlko
Rehlko has been an innovative leader in energy resilience for over 100 years. Beginning with the first modern generator, the Rehlko Automatic Power & Light, launched in 1920, our product range includes engines, generators, power conversion, UPS systems, EV components and electrification solutions, microgrid controls and management, clean energy solutions, and much more that serve a broad spectrum of OEM, residential, industrial, and commercial customers.

Position Overview An Environmental Health and Safety Specialist reports to the EHS Manager at the Mosel facility. Directly assists in developing, implementing and supporting programs to improve and maintain safety and environmental performance.
Responsibilities
Assist with accident investigations.
Administer and maintain OSHA required safety programs (hazard communication, lockout/tagout, confined space entry, personal protective equipment, machine guarding, etc.).
Conduct environmental health and safety audits and follow up with corrective actions.
Develop and implement projects to improve safety performance (ergonomics, safety awareness, recognition program, etc.).
Address employee environmental health and safety concerns/issues as necessary.
Conduct environmental health and safety training.
Support facility First Responder Squad.
Attend monthly EHS Committee meetings.
Support Divisional ISO compliance efforts.
Assist with all aspects of environmental program management (stormwater/wastewater management, waste management, Title V management, remediation project management, etc.).
Act as liaison with all Federal, state and local regulatory agencies.
Support the KOS Improvement System.
Other duties as required.
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ree or higher in EHS or relevant field.
Three to five years experience in the environmental health and safety field.
Experience with union groups is preferred.
Experience with Gensuite is a plus.
The Salary range for this position is $69,800.00–$87,950.00.
Competitive Benefits and Compensation Rehlko offers a competitive salary, health, vision, dental, and additional benefits.
Location: Sheboygan, WI.
